Job description

About Nexus Neurorecovery Center – Conroe

Nexus Neurorecovery Center in Conroe is part of Nexus Health Systems, a leading provider of specialized healthcare services for individuals with complex medical, neurological, and behavioral conditions. Our Neurorecovery program provides interdisciplinary, patient-centered care focused on improving functional independence and quality of life for patients with neurologic and developmental disorders.

Our team includes physicians, therapists, psychologists, nurses, and behavioral health professionals working together in a highly collaborative, mission-driven environment.

Position Summary

Nexus Neurorecovery Center is seeking a Physical Therapist to provide specialized therapeutic services to patients with neurological, developmental, and medically complex conditions. This role requires strong clinical skills, interdisciplinary collaboration, and a passion for helping patients achieve the highest possible level of independence and function.

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form comprehensive physical therapy evaluations and develop individualized treatment plans
  • Provide evidence-based therapy focused on motor control, mobility, balance, gait, and functional movement
  • Treat patients with neurologic, developmental, and complex medical conditions
  • Collaborate with occupational therapy, speech therapy, psychology, nursing, and medical staff
  • Utilize adaptive equipment, assistive technology, and therapeutic modalities as appropriate
  • Educate patients and families on therapy goals and home programming
  • Maintain accurate and timely clinical documentation in the electronic medical record
  • Participate in interdisciplinary team meetings, case conferences, and care planning
  • Support program development and quality improvement initiatives
  • Follow all regulatory, safety, and compliance standards
